What will I learn?

No matter the industry, no matter the business, managers play a key role in bringing diverse stakeholders and team members together to achieve common goals. From negotiating deadlines and budgets to overseeing projects and workgroups, management skills are integral to a variety of career paths. The management and innovation concentration in the CSU College of Business refines your natural leadership skills. Through coursework taught by knowledgeable and engaging faculty, you’ll learn the skills you need to innovate, lead others and make informed and ethical decisions that advance both short- and long-term efforts.

Entry requirements

For international students

Students need to submit their most-recent transcripts or mark sheets. If a record is not in English, a certified literal English translation must accompany the official transcript. Only transcripts sent directly from the school or stamped and sealed are considered official. Admissions decisions are provisional until we receive your final transcript verifying graduation. In general, students with a 3.0+ GPA (on a 4.0 scale) and a steady or upward trend in grades are admitted to CSU.

About Colorado State University

With research projects in over 85 countries and +2000 international students, CSU has the atmosphere and influence of a globalized institution.

  • Leading research university
  • +500 undergraduate and graduate programs
  • Diverse student body representing over 100 countries
  • Leader in sustainability and environmental awareness
